    To apply for PhD, candidates need to appear for a PhD entrance test conducted by the University. However, candidates with UGC NET/ UGC CSIR NET/ GATE score are exempted from the entrance test. Final selection of shortlisted PhD candidates takes place on the basis of PI round conducted by the University and past academic performance.

Yes, a BCom  (H) is available at Christ University for students to pursue. It is a UG-level course offered in full-time mode. The duration of this programme is three years. Moreover, the university also offers students the opportunity to obtain an Hons or Hons with research degree by continuing the course for a fourth year. Apart from the general BCom course, the university also offers the BCom (Financial Analytics/Hons/Hons with Research) course. Admission to these courses is made based on scores obtained in the in-house entrance test.

Christ University Lavasa offers a Master of Business Administration (MBA) programme admitting 180 students. Situated in Lavasa near Pune, the campus fosters a vibrant educational setting. Eligibility requires a valid score from tests like MAT, CAT, CMAT, XAT, GMAT, GRE, or ATMA, along with a bachelor's degree with 50% aggregate marks. The two-year postgraduate course entails a total tuition fee of INR 8.40 lakh. Embracing an eco-friendly atmosphere, the Lavasa campus nurtures a robust value system.
